Ingredients
Eggs ( 3 ) | Egg tart crust ( 7 span> ) |
Low-gluten flour ( 10g ) | Frosting ( 15g ) |
Condensed milk ( 10g ) | Pure milk ( 75ml ) |
How to make microwave egg tarts

1.Take out the seven egg tart shells from the freezer compartment in advance and defrost them.

2. Prepare other ingredients and weigh them.

3.Crack the eggs into a plate and stir well (whole egg version, there is no need to separate the egg white and yolk).

4.Add icing sugar (using icing sugar is easy to blend into the egg liquid, if using white sugar, it can be simmered with pure milk melted by heating).

5.Add pure milk and stir together evenly.

6. Then add low-gluten flour and stir until there are no powder particles.

7. Add condensed milk and mix well.

8.The egg liquid is ready.

9. Pour the egg liquid into the egg tart shell until it is eight minutes full.

10. Place in the microwave turntable (there must be a gap between each egg tart, otherwise it will be connected to The silver tart tray together will spark off) and set the heat to high for 2 minutes.

11. Until you see the egg tarts in the oven rising high, turn to medium heat for 2 minutes.

12. After taking it out of the oven, let it cool slightly before eating.
Tips
When putting it in the microwave, there must be a gap between each egg tart, otherwise the silver tart holders connected together will cause sparks, remember!
